Terminator Old-Timey Member Posted March 31, 2024 Posted March 31, 2024 It’s two games but it’s essentially the same lineup as last year. So really it’s like a 167 game sample Yeah but the offense was good last year. Finished tied for 7th in wRC+ and that was with several key guys having down years. People just think it was bad because we had some luck/clutch issues that are unlikely to repeat (and in fact improved toward the end of the year) and people weren’t baking in the new park factors into their perceptions of what the offense should be. If Vlad, Kirk, Varsho and Springer rebound like they are projected to the offense should be pretty good.
